RK26
resistors
radial metal film leaded resistors
features
Lead frame construction
High density assembly and excellent self-standing strength
Marking: Blue body color with color dot marking
for resistance and tolerance values
Products with lead-free terminations meet
RoHS requirements. Pb located in glass material,
electrode and resistor element is exempt per Annex 1,
exemption 5 of EU directive 2005/95/EC
